It helps stabilize cash flow
Factoring invoices is a great way for businesses to stabilize their cash flow. It’s an alternative to a traditional loan and can provide money to pay for expenses that are urgent. It also helps businesses to get ahead of their expenses.
A company with a steady cash flow will be able to grow more quickly. This allows them to boost production, finance marketing campaigns, and even add new product lines. They can also repair equipment or pay staff.

If you run a B2B business, invoice factoring may be an effective option to aid in raising working capital. Factoring invoices with a financial institution can enable you to access cash in just a few days. This is a great way to solve unexpected cash flow issues.
The best companies for invoice factoring have a variety of options to select from. Certain companies offer fast funding with no minimums. Other companies, such as eCapital offer specific services for small-sized businesses. Before you decide on a company you must consider your specific needs.

Factoring can help you establish an excellent track of solid cash management. It’s also a great way to increase your company’s credit. It doesn’t do the same due diligence that banks do on a particular client.
For many, the biggest advantage of invoice factoring is that it allows you to convert your outstanding invoices into cash. You will be able to finance your expenses and also grow your business. A good factoring business will reimburse you up to 90 percent of the invoice’s value.
